ESCO occupation

mechanical engineering drafter

Back to ESCO occupations

Mechanical engineering drafters convert mechanical engineers' designs and sketches into technical drawings detailing dimensions, fastening and assembling methods and other specifications used for example in manufacturing processes.

CAD software

The computer-aided design (CAD) software for creating, modifying, analysing or optimising a design.

digital
Scope note
CAD software should be differentiated from computer-aided design and drafting (CADD) software. CADD systems are CAD systems with additional drafting features. For example, CADD systems enable an engineer or architect to insert size annotations and other notes into a design.

3D modelling

The process of developing a mathematical representation of any three-dimensional surface of an object via specialised software. The product is called a 3D model. It can be displayed as a two-dimensional image through a process called 3D rendering or used in a computer simulation of physical phenomena. The model can also be physically created using 3D printing devices.

CADD software

The computer-aided design and drafting (CADD) is the use of computer technology for design and design documentation. CAD software replaces manual drafting with an automated process.

digital
Scope note
CADD software should be differentiated from computer-aided design (CAD) software. CADD systems are CAD systems with additional drafting features enabling the user to insert size annotations and other notes into a design.
